Restorative yoga and yin are both relatively new onto the yoga scene having both been popularized within the last 50 years, but they come from two different lineages. Restorative yoga was founded by B.K.S Iyengar in the 1950s as a way for students to be able to work on their alignment in postures through long holds, but take all of the pressure ...Oct 4, 2022 ... Jan 7, 2020 · Restorative yoga, also called gentle yoga, is a style of yoga designed to relax, restore, and rejuvenate the body, mind, and spirit. Restorative yoga falls under the umbrella of hatha yoga , an ancient form of yoga with origins in India, which is intended to stretch and strengthen the physical body in preparation for seated meditation.

Make a long loop with your yoga strap, preferably an …Jul 12, 2022 · Restorative yoga is “a type of yoga known for its relaxing, calming and healing effects.”. It involves holding poses for about five to 10 minutes, often with the help from props, such as blankets, bolsters and blocks, that help support your body so you can relax.
